site stats

How to calculate worst case time complexity

Web4 apr. 2024 · Calculating the Time Complexity for the following Algorithms. We will determine the different time complexity of algorithms, in terms of big O notation, we will … Web3 okt. 2024 · If we calculate the total time complexity, it would be something like this: 1 total = time (statement1) + time (statement2) + ... time (statementN) Let’s use T (n) as the total time in function of the input size n, and t as the time complexity taken by a statement or group of statements. 1

Understanding time complexity with Python examples

Web19 feb. 2012 · We define an algorithm’s worst-case time complexity by using the Big-O notation, which determines the set of functions grows slower than or at the same rate as … Web6 feb. 2016 · For a sentinel sequential search, find the average case if the probability is 0 <= p <= 1. I get the worst case would be O(n+1) as there would be n elements in the … costco fire sense patio heater parts https://videotimesas.com

Worst, Average and Best Case Analysis of Algorithms

Web4 apr. 2024 · The above definition says in the worst case, let the function f (n) be your algorithm's runtime, and g (n) be an arbitrary time complexity you are trying to relate to your algorithm. Then O (g (n)) says that the function f (n) never grows faster than g (n) that is f (n)<=g (n) and g (n) is the maximum number of steps that the algorithm can attain. Web29 nov. 2024 · Worst Case Time Complexity Analysis Let’s assume that we choose a pivot element in such a way that it gives the most unbalanced partitions possible: All the … Web11 sep. 2024 · Bound the worst case run time of each program using big-O notation. Problem 1: i = 1, total = 0 while i < n/2: total = total + A [i] i=i*2 Problem 2: total = 0 S = … breakers bed and breakfast eastbourne

how to estimate best, worst and average cases for time complexity?

Category:Solved Find the worst-case time complexity of the Chegg.com

Tags:How to calculate worst case time complexity

How to calculate worst case time complexity

how to estimate best, worst and average cases for time complexity?

Web9 okt. 2024 · Developers typically solve for the worst case scenario, Big-O, because you’re not expecting your algorithm to run in the best or even average cases when calculating time complexity of an algorithm. It allows you to make analytical statements such as, “well, in the worst case scenario, my algorithm will scale this quickly”. Common running ... WebWorst case - when the number is prime - is quite obvious O(sqrt(n)) Best case happens when number can be divided by 2,3,5,7,9. In these cases we will terminate the loop …

How to calculate worst case time complexity

Did you know?

Web4 mrt. 2024 · When analyzing the time complexity of an algorithm we may find three cases: best-case, average-case and worst-case. Let’s understand what it means. … Web7 nov. 2013 · In the worst case the list must be fully traversed (you are always inserting the next-smallest item into the ascending list). Then you have 1 + 2 + ... n, which is still …

WebWorst-case time complexity. Worst-case time complexity denotes the longest running time W ( n) of an algorithm given any input of size n. It gives an upper bound on time requirements and is often easy to compute. The drawback is that it … WebWorst Case Time complexity Analysis of Merge Sort We can divide Merge Sort into 2 steps: Dividing the input array into two equal halves using recursion which takes logarithmic time complexity ie. log (n), where n is number of elements in the input array. Let's take T1 (n) = Time complexity of dividing the array T1 (n) = T1 (n/2) + T1 (n/2)

WebWorst case: If there is a skewed or an unbalanced binary search tree we have to travel from root to last or deepest leaf node and height of the tree becomes n. So time complexity will be O (n) as searching each node one by one till last leaf node takes O (n) time and then we will insert the element which takes constant time. WebThe worst-case time complexity W(n) is then defined as W(n) = max(T 1 (n), T 2 (n), …). The worst-case time complexity for the contains algorithm thus becomes W( n ) = n . Worst-case time complexity gives an upper bound …

WebFind the worst-case time complexity of the FriendOfFriend algorithm below when using an adjacency matrix to represent the graph. Show your work. Previous question Next question. This problem has been solved! You'll get a detailed solution from a subject matter expert that helps you learn core concepts.

WebTime Complexity in case of a complete graph: O (E V) = O ( V 2) * O ( V ) = O (V 3) Space complexity: O (V) [Linear space] V being the number of vertices. Average Case Time Complexity We can improve the worst case running time by terminating the algorithm when the iterations make no changes to the path values. This will lead to fewer iterations. breakers beach weddingWeb8 nov. 2024 · The Zestimate® home valuation model is Zillow’s estimate of a home’s market value. A Zestimate incorporates public, MLS and user-submitted data into Zillow’s proprietary formula, also taking into account home facts, location and market trends. It is not an appraisal and can’t be used in place of an appraisal. breakers bed and breakfastWeb7 nov. 2024 · The time complexity of Linear Search in the best case is O (1). In the worst case, the time complexity is O (n). Time Complexity of Binary Search: Binary Search is the faster of the two searching algorithms. However, for smaller arrays, linear search does a better job. The time complexity of Binary Search in the best case is O (1). costco fire sense patio heater 1031510